The Power of Natural Cleaners

But wait, there’s more! Not only are we going to use a soft cloth, but we’re also going to ditch the harsh chemicals in favor of some good old-fashioned natural cleaners. Now, I know what you’re thinking – “Adam, are you telling me I have to make my own cleaning solutions?” Nope, not at all! There are plenty of readily available, eco-friendly options out there that can tackle even the toughest messes.

One of my personal favorites is a simple mixture of white vinegar and water. Just mix equal parts of each in a spray bottle, and voila – you’ve got a powerhouse of a cleaner that’s safe for your family and the environment. Another great option is baking soda. Yep, that unassuming little box in your fridge can be a real lifesaver when it comes to cutting through grease and grime.

The Importance of Patience

Now, I know what you’re thinking – “But Adam, won’t these natural cleaners take forever to work?” Well, my friends, that’s where a little patience comes in. You see, the key to using natural cleaners is to let them do their thing. Spray on that vinegar and water solution, let it sit for a few minutes, and then go to town with your trusty microfiber cloth. The same goes for baking soda – let it sit and work its magic before scrubbing.

Preventing Future Messes

Alright, so we’ve conquered the initial cleaning battle, but what about the war against future stains and spills? Well, my friends, I’ve got a few more tricks up my sleeve.

First and foremost, it’s all about being proactive. Wipe up spills as soon as they happen, and don’t let them sit and dry out. And when it comes to cooking, make sure to use splatter guards and keep a close eye on those bubbling sauces.

Another helpful tip? Try to avoid sliding heavy pots and pans across the glass surface. This can cause scratches and make it even harder to keep your stove looking its best. Instead, lift and place your cookware gently to preserve that pristine finish.

Dealing with the Toughest Messes

But what about those really stubborn, caked-on messes that just won’t budge, no matter how much elbow grease you put in? Well, my friends, that’s where a little ingenuity comes in.

One trick I’ve learned over the years is to use a razor blade scraper. Now, I know what you’re thinking – “Adam, won’t that scratch up my stove?” Nope, not if you’re careful and use it properly. Gently glide the blade over the affected area, being sure to keep it flat against the surface. It’s like a mini-spatula for your stove, and it can work wonders on those really tough, dried-up messes.

And if that’s still not cutting it (pun intended), try mixing up a paste of baking soda and water, applying it to the problem area, and letting it sit for a bit before scrubbing. The abrasive power of the baking soda can work magic on even the most stubborn stains.
